Monday Sketchbook 2/24/14


This is a rough sketch for a group concept I've been playing around with. I love the style of the velocipede uniforms for women in the late 1890's - the huge sleeves, the tweed, etc. Because I am into steamPUNK, I want to highlight the punk aspect of it, and think about what would a Victorian "biker chick" look like.

I also may or may not have been inspired by Kate Beaton's "Velocipedestrienne" comic :)

Monday Sketchbook 9/16/2013


I am planning my costumes for Pandoracon, and I really want to do a female version of the Goblin King. I know many women have before just done his costume, but I want to do an actual crossplay. This is based on his outfit during Dance Magic Dance, with a gray skirt, black vest, and super frilly white shirt. It's definitely the simplest of his costumes, but since I have Teslacon to get ready for as well, it's probably for the best. I'm giving it a slight steampunk/victorian flair with the bone bustle and corset.
